Drug Name: HMS
HMS DESCRIPTION:
CORTICOSTEROIDS - OPHTHALMIC DROPS
COMMON HMS BRAND NAME(S):
Decadron, Econopred, HMS, Maxidex, Pred Mild
HMS SIDE EFFECTS:
The side effects listed assume short-term use of HMS. HMS may temporarily sting when first applied. If it persists or becomes bothersome, inform your doctor. Vision may be temporarily blurred after applying eye medication. Use caution if driving or performing duties requiring clear vision. Notify your doctor if you develop skin rash, itching, Notify your doctor if you develop: skin rash, itching, redness or swelling in or around the eyes. Very unlikely effects: persistent vision problems, watering eye(s), eye pain. If you notice other effects not listed above, contact your doctor or pharmacist.
HOW TO USE HMS:
HMS: Use this as prescribed. To apply eye medication, wash hands first. Be careful not to touch the dropper tip or let it touch the affected area to avoid contamination. Shake suspension form well before using. Tilt your head back, gaze upward and pull down the lower eyelid to make a pouch. Place dropper directly over eye and administer the prescribed number of drops. Look downward and gently close your eye for 1 to 2 minutes. If you are using another kind of eye medication, wait five to ten minutes before applying.
HMS USES:
HMS is used to treat swelling and itching of the eye (ophthalmic).
HMS PRECAUTIONS:
Before using HMS, tell your doctor: any allergies, infections, eye problems. Using contact lenses during treatment with HMS may increase the chance of developing an eye infection. Prolonged use may result in glaucoma, cataracts, and other eye problems. Consult your doctor or pharmacist. HMS should be used only when clearly needed during pregnancy. Discuss the risks and benefits with your doctor. Consult your doctor if breast-feeding.

MISSED HMS DOSE:
If you miss a dose, use it as soon as remembered; do not use if it is almost time for the next dose, instead, skip the missed dose and resume your usual dosing schedule. Do not "double-up" the dose to catch up.
HMS STORAGE:
Store at room temperature away from sunlight. Avoid freezing.
